U.S. Engineers study new German glass mine. Components of a German glass mine nicknamed oitment box by U.S. soldiers, with its cover, are displayed on a field near Musbach, Germany, where the mine was safely unearthed and dismantled by American Army engineerd. The centerpiece of the plastic-encased mine is completely made of glass, with the exception of the detonator (right). The glass bowl containing the explosive and pressure plate cover are devised to avoid detection by ordinaty mine-detectors which register the pressure of metal, yet these mines have also been discovered and successfully dismantled.
